sql >> Databasteknik >  >> RDS >> Mysql

MySQL-delsträngsmatchning med reguljärt uttryck; delsträng innehåller 'man' inte 'kvinna'

Du kan använda två uttryck. Jag tror like är tillräckligt:

SELECT ('#stylemanclothing' like '%man%' and '#stylemanclothing' not like '%woman%')

Även om du kan uttrycka detta i ett reguljärt uttryck, är detta förmodligen den enklaste lösningen.



  1. Konvertera datetime-värdet till sträng

  2. Adjacency List till JSON-graf med Postgres

  3. Hur man får värden för varje dag under en månad

  4. mysql Sök efter en sträng i tabellkolumnen med annan ordning